Several organizations and research institutions are actively working on malaria vaccines, including the University of Oxford, the Walter Reed Army Institute of Research, and the pharmaceutical company GlaxoSmithKline. Notably, the RTS,S/AS01 vaccine, developed by GSK and implemented in pilot programs in Africa, is one of the first to receive a recommendation for widespread use. Additionally, the PATH Malaria Vaccine Initiative is collaborating with various partners to advance new vaccine candidates in clinical trials. Ongoing research continues to explore innovative approaches to enhance vaccine efficacy and accessibility.
